The new Confetti Cuts Treat Tote is AWESOME with it's large-scale pinked top! I LOVE this new die...not only is it a super fun little treat tote, but I will be using it as a cool layer and background on cards! An Cast a Spell sentiment was trimmed out to use as a banner over the Cast a Spell witch stamped and cut from Confetti Cuts Cast a Spell, while you see the Confetti Cuts Pretty Panels Stars peeking out from behind!

Stamps: Cast a Spell (Reverse Confetti)
Ink: Black, Burnt Orange (Simon Says Stamp)
Paper: Primitive White (MFT), Mischievous (My Mind's Eye)
Other: Confetti Cuts Treats Tote, Confetti Cuts Pretty Panels Stars, Confetti Cuts Cast a Spell (Reverse Confetti), Metallic Black & Natural Twine (The Twinery), 4mm & 6mm Aquamarine Sequins (Pretty Pink Posh)
